Default Predator tuning

Receiving my predator tomorrow, looking for tips on where to start. My car is an 02 c5 6 speed, no mufflers, dual cone intake, carbon fiber air bridge, smooth coupler no screen in MAF, and MSD ignition. I plan on dropping the fan settings, what about fuel and timing? Wonder if I could pull off a tune with this handheld after I install a mayhem cam. Thanks for any tips

Drop fan settings some, log your ltfts and tune accordingly for those... dont touch timing unless you know what your doing but with your mods it shouldnt need anymore. No you cannot tune for a cam with it unless you find somebody with a cmr suite and pay them.

Fans are lowered a bit in the tunes, but you can play with them as much as you like.
I wouldn't mess with the WOT fuel settings unless you have a wideband, so you know where you are at and which way to go

You can do some logging to see if you have any knock and adjust timing accordingly, but again, it is optimized in the preloaded tunes.
